F. Litré is a scholar working on Surgery, Epidemiology and Neurology. According to data from OpenAlex, F. Litré has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 165 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Surgery, 5 papers in Epidemiology and 4 papers in Neurology. Recurrent topics in F. Litré's work include Meningioma and schwannoma management (4 papers),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(3 papers) and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(3 papers). F. Litré is often cited by papers focused on Meningioma and schwannoma management (4 papers),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(3 papers) and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(3 papers). F. Litré collaborates with scholars based in France and United States. F. Litré's co-authors include P. Rousseaux, P Peruzzi, K. Kadziolka, L. Pierot, Philippe Colin, A. Bazin, Nicolas Jovenin, Nathalie Bednarek, Martine Patey and Matthieu Vinchon and has published in prestigious journals such as American Journal of Neuroradiology, Radiotherapy and Oncology and Frontiers in Endocrinology.
